Output 6088936a07709175ea54b0207366e73ae8ef92ca678cd03fba5925507f4de861:0

value
25000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 142d845a578d67e14337d4cf59b80dca008e7373 OP_EQUALVERIFY OP_CHECKSIG
address
12qh3QysDQRmBFY71KEvGvNZcxmiTqLReN
transaction
6088936a07709175ea54b0207366e73ae8ef92ca678cd03fba5925507f4de861
confirmations
540405
spent
true